In relation to construction, the Precision Bass is created to past. Its stable entire body is usually crafted from alder or ash, both of those of that happen to be recognized for their toughness and tonal characteristics. The neck is often maple, which has a rosewood or maple fingerboard, providing a sleek playing encounter. Fender's notice to detail makes sure that Every Precision Bass is don't just a bit of artwork but additionally a trusted instrument which can endure the rigors of touring and frequent use.

Talking of renowned players, Enable’s not fail to remember the legends which have wielded the Precision Bass. James Jamerson, whose bass traces defined the Motown seem, relied on his trusty P-Bass to produce some of the most unforgettable grooves in songs history. Carol Kaye, another studio legend, made use of the P-Bass on plenty of hits from the sixties and '70s. Then there is Paul McCartney, who, Whilst primarily connected with the Hofner, also used the P-Bass to wonderful influence in his write-up-Beatles occupation.

Now, let us take a journey down memory lane and have a look at a few of the traditional products in the Precision Bass. The 1951 original, with its single-coil pickup, set the phase for all the things that adopted. The 1957 model released the break up-coil pickup, which became a defining aspect. Through the years, various iterations and special editions have retained the P-Bass new and relevant, Just about every introducing its own twist for the traditional components.
